Description
In the picturesque and old village centre of the municipality of Gordola stands this property consisting of four houses. One of these houses is attached to the main house.
The large main house, an old Ticino house, around 1640, is the oldest house in the municipality and originally stood in the middle of vines. This is evidenced by 3 wine cellars on top of each other.
The houses were completely renovated in 2024. The roofs are newly covered with original Ticino granite slabs. The facilities are modern, combined with old furniture.
The main house is systemically structured, the granite staircase provides access to all 3 floors as well as the attic.

The house is very suitable as a family home, as you can be together and independent at the same time. Quite exciting for children. The house is fully furnished and ready to move in immediately.
The second house is completely independent with open plan living area, fireplace, dining area, small charming kitchen, bedroom for children in small gable and upstairs parents' bedroom with small bathroom, toilet. In the basement is the imposing and second oldest Trotte in the canton with a small kitchenette, an ideal place for festivities. Attached towards the street is complemented by an old building with garage for 2 small cars or 1 off-road vehicle.
The 4th house is about 200 years old and originally had a baking / pizza oven on the ground floor, which is no longer active. On the first floor is the office with a small covered terrace.
The garden with cobblestones and various plants such as palm trees, oleanders, camellias invites you to socialize. Let the magic of bygone times catch up with you. This is a place suitable for a large family, for people looking for something out of the ordinary.
